Natural Wonders:
Chitrakote Falls: Situated in the Bastar district of Chhattisgarh, the awe-inspiring Chitrakote Falls is often dubbed the “Niagara of India” due to its striking resemblance to the iconic North American waterfall. The horseshoe-shaped cascade tumbles from about 100 feet into the Indravati River, creating a breathtaking spectacle that captivates visitors. The surrounding lush greenery and the mist rising from the cascading waters add to the enchanting atmosphere of this natural wonder.
Kanger Valley National Park: Nestled amidst the dense forests of Bastar, Kanger Valley National Park is a sanctuary for a diverse array of flora and fauna. The park is home to elusive big cats like tigers and leopards, as well as various species of deer, making it a paradise for wildlife enthusiasts. Adventure seekers can explore the park’s rugged terrain on trekking expeditions and marvel at the magnificent Kutumsar Caves, where intricate stalactite and stalagmite formations create an otherworldly underground landscape.

Cultural Heritage:
Sirpur: Steeped in antiquity, the ancient city of Sirpur stands as a testament to Chhattisgarh’s rich historical legacy. The remnants of majestic temples, elegant palaces, and other architectural marvels dating back centuries offer a glimpse into the region’s illustrious past. One of the highlights is the tranquil Budha Ghat, where the Seonath River converges with the mighty Mahanadi, providing a serene setting for contemplation and introspection.
Rajim: Renowned as a significant religious center, Rajim is adorned with ancient temples dedicated to Lord Shiva, serving as a testament to the region’s deep-rooted spiritual heritage. The grand festival of Mahotsav, celebrated with zeal and devotion, draws multitudes of pilgrims and devotees from across the country, adding to the cultural vibrancy of the town.
